Responsibilities:
- Designs portions of engineering solutions utilizing multiple engineering disciplines for products, systems, software, and solutions based on established engineering principles and in accordance with development technology practices and guidelines.
- Develops and implements parameters and test plans for existing designs, including validation of mechanical, electrical, software, and other engineering specifications and requirements.
- Collaborates and communicates with internal and outsourced development partners on engineering design and development.
- Participates as a member of project team of other engineers and internal and outsourced development partners to develop reliable, cost-effective and high-quality solutions for low to moderately- complex products.
Education and Experience Required:
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Electrical Engineering or related fields.
- Typically 1-5 years experience.
Knowledge and Skills:
- Using appropriate engineering design tools and software packages to design components and solutions.
- Ability to apply anal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Understanding of material properties and hardware, software, and electrical component design.
- Understanding of material properties and hardware, software, and electrical component design.
- Using empirical analysis, modeling, and testing methodologies to validate product designs and specifications.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ills; mastery in English and local language. Ability to effectively communicate design proposals and negotiate options.
